SOUTH SIOUX CITY - A South Sioux City police officer was shot after an early morning gunfight. At 2:08 a.m. this morning, South Sioux City Police say that “an Officer involved shooting took place at Los Amigos 1313 Dakota Ave, South Sioux City, NE. A person at that location reported seeing an individual in possession of a firearm. The first responding South Sioux City Police Officer made contact with a male outside of that business. Shortly after that contact, shots were fired. The South Sioux City Officer and male both sustained injuries and were transported to a nearby hospital by the South Sioux City Fire Department. This is an ongoing investigation and no other details will be released at this time.”
